Chelsea forward Pedro: "It was a very difficult game"

Pedro hopes to end the season on a high with FA Cup success and a top-four finish in the Premier League, having passed a "very difficult" test against Leicester City.

Pedro has called on his Chelsea teammates to take belief from their FA Cup quarter-final win over Leicester City into their Premier League campaign.

The Blues booked a place in the last four of the competition by battling to a 2-1 victory at the King Power Stadium on Sunday afternoon.

An evenly-matched tie was settled by Pedro, who made the most of Kasper Schmeichel's decision to come out for a cross that he failed to collect in the 15th minute of extra time.

Having kept alive his side's hopes of landing some silverware, four days on from exiting the Champions League in the last 16, Pedro hopes to push on in the Premier League and salvage a top-four spot.

"It was a very difficult game. It was good for me to score for my confidence and to get to the next round," he told BBC Sport. "It was hard to find the pass in between the lines. Leicester defended very well and pressed high. It is difficult to win against this team.

"The most important thing for us was the teamwork and to make it through to the next round. We have to fight in the next few games. It is a difficult situation for us in the league but we have to fight.

"We have a good opportunity to go to the final and fight for a place in the top four [of the Premier League]. But now is the moment to relax and enjoy this win."

Chelsea, who face Southampton in next month's semi-final, are currently five points adrift of the Champions League spots.
